Transaction a91a20e9e4c533bbb2fd76275851fa2e279a5db0f7131b7104c826d1cebcfc34
2 Input
2 Outputs
- a91a20e9e4c533bbb2fd76275851fa2e279a5db0f7131b7104c826d1cebcfc34:0
- a91a20e9e4c533bbb2fd76275851fa2e279a5db0f7131b7104c826d1cebcfc34:1
value 21427
address 1EDeYfTFgrXzCBF2A8ji21GLPMDaBajns5
value 11551000
address 32Ze31KaPkHWEhpQhUCfTPooW2MxxQvDD3